DIY Options vs. Professional Services

You likely have some basic lawn maintenance knowledge, but landscaping requires advanced skills, intense labor, and heavy equipment. Complicated landscaping projects, such as adding an irrigation system or fire pit, also require machinery and construction experience.

Small landscaping projects, such as removing overgrown plants or adding flower beds, can be easy projects to DIY. If you don't have basic lawn expertise or are looking for a complete yard overhaul, consider hiring a professional.

Professional landscape architects and designers can enhance your lawn, recommend the most cost-effective upgrades, and help you develop a long-term maintenance plan. These professionals have the skills and knowledge to elevate your outdoor space. Contactors that also provide lawn care services can improve the health of your lawn and help you avoid costly mistakes.

Factors To Consider When Choosing an Kentwood Landscaping Company

Experience and reputation are important considerations when hiring a landscaper, but you also want to ensure that the provider offers the services you need at a reasonable price. Consider the following factors when hiring a landscaping contractor.

Services Offered

Assess your landscaping needs before choosing a company. If you’re looking for assistance with yard health and maintenance, look for one that offers lawn care services. These services might include mowing, fertilizing, pruning, controlling weeds, and mulching. Some companies offer additional pest control services and tree removal.

Look for a full-service landscaping company if you're adding new outdoor elements (such as a fire pit) or planning a revamp of your whole yard. These providers specialize in outdoor designs and upgrades, such as gardening, landscaping rock projects, and adding hardscapes. They can also help install fire pits, retaining walls, sprinkler or irrigation systems, and other architectural elements, and some even provide lawn maintenance services.

Licensing and Experience

Most landscape contractors have advanced training and certifications in certain areas, such as horticulture, lawn maintenance, and outdoor design. Companies should possess the appropriate licenses from the Kentwood city government. Your provider may have the following certified staff members:

  • Certified fertilization or pesticide specialists
  • Licensed arborists
  • Licensed horticulture specialists
  • Licensed or certified landscaping designers or architects
It may also hold certifications from professional organizations, including the National Association of Landscape Professionals and the Professional Landcare Network. While not mandatory, these certifications show a contractor's commitment to their profession. Ask to see a certificate of insurance or a company's insurance numbers before beginning a project. All landscaping companies should be insured and bonded. Contractors normally have liability insurance to protect against property damage or bodily injury.

Reputation and Reviews

Seek out companies with positive customer reviews and strong reputations. We recommend checking third-party review sites such as the Better Business Bureau. Explore both negative and positive reviews for each company to gauge how it treats its customers. Be wary of companies with mainly negative customer reviews and frequent mentions of delayed projects, unreliable customer service, or poor project results.

Work Portfolio

Most landscaping and maintenance contractors proudly share their finished projects with potential customers. Ask to see a portfolio of your provider's landscaping designs and projects. They may also have before and after pictures to show the quality of their work. Ask about completed landscape designs similar to your planned project to get a better idea of how it will look.

Sustainability Practices

Sustainability is important to consider both during and after landscaping work. Ask your landscaper about its best practices for eco-friendly material options, water conservation, and waste management; you can also ask for maintenance recommendations. Landscaping providers should choose native plants (such as swamp milkweed, wild columbine, and cup-plant) when planting new vegetation, and they shouldn't allow their work to affect your existing vegetation.

Cost

We recommend requesting multiple quotes from different companies. This lets you compare rates and services and might even help you negotiate a better price. Many providers offer free consultations to review your outdoor space, discuss project plans, and make recommendations. Your detailed quote will include information about various project costs, such as materials and labor.

Landscaping Costs in Kentwood

Landscaping typically costs $24–$36 per hour in Kentwood, depending on project type and size. Simple tasks like gardening or mowing will cost less than significant yard work, such as resodding. Bigger projects need more labor, which increases the total cost. Depending on the size of your yard, the company may charge by the acre. The cost will also be influenced by the materials you choose. Here's the average cost of different landscaping services:

Landscaping ServiceAverage Cost
Deck$12,649 - $16,866
Landscaping Design$1,826 - $2,434
Landscaping LandGrading$408 - $2,449
Landscaping Mulch$24 - $122
Planting FlowerBeds$82 - $1,633
Planting Trees$214 - $357
Sodding$41 - $49
Swimming Pool$31,022 - $81,637

Frequently Asked Questions About Landscaping in Kentwood

What are some warning signs of a bad landscaping company?

Warning signs of a bad landscaper include lack of professionalism, no formal contract, lack of proper licensing, and numerous negative reviews. Poor communication is a red flag for any contractor. You should also avoid companies that use high-pressure sales tactics or that request payment up front before completing any work.

What are the benefits of landscaping?

There are numerous benefits to landscaping, including increasing your home's value and improving its curb appeal. Landscaping can also add more natural beauty to your home and improve your quality of life with usable outdoor spaces.

Are landscapers the same as gardeners?

No, a landscaper is not the same as a gardener. Landscapers enhance your yard's visual appeal by incorporating plant life, architectural elements, and outdoor features to create an outdoor living space. Gardeners focus only on maintaining your garden or plants.

What is a landscape designer?

A landscape designer reviews, plans, and designs outdoor living spaces. They offer functional and aesthetic property enhancements. Their designs might include decorative upgrades, garden plants, or hardscape elements (such as walkways). Landscape designers collaborate with landscape artists to construct the final design.

How do I negotiate pricing with a landscaping company?

Homeowners should request quotes from multiple providers before negotiating. Detailed quotes should include a breakdown of the cost, including labor, materials, and other fees. Be clear about your budget and prepared to compromise on certain elements if necessary. If you're unable to negotiate a better rate, ask your company if it offers payment plans.
